Latest Patents
Taku Hanna holds a patent for an oxide semiconductor thin film, thin film transistor, method producing the same, and sputtering target. This invention includes an oxide semiconductor that mainly contains indium (In), tin (Sn), and germanium (Ge). The atom ratio of Ge/(In+Sn+Ge) is specified to be 0.07 or more and 0.40 or less. As a result, this innovation achieves transistor characteristics with a mobility of 10 cm/Vs or more.
